The great importance of the structure of continents for the fate of mankind is indisputable. The gap between the eastern and western hemispheres disappeared only 500 years ago with the voyages of the Spaniards and Portuguese to America. Before this, connections between the peoples of both hemispheres existed mainly only in the northern part of the Pacific Ocean.

The deep penetration of the northern continents into the Arctic has long made routes around their northern shores inaccessible. The close convergence of the three main oceans in the area of ​​the three Mediterranean seas created the possibility of connecting them with each other naturally (Strait of Malacca) or artificially (Suez Canal, Panama Canal). The chains of mountains and their location predetermined the movement of peoples. Vast plains led to the unification of people under one state will, strongly dissected spaces contributed to maintaining state fragmentation.

The dismemberment of America by rivers, lakes and mountains led to the formation of Indian peoples who, due to their isolation, could not resist the Europeans. Seas, continents, mountain ranges and rivers form natural boundaries between countries and peoples (F. Fatzel, 1909).

Physical card

a general geographical map that conveys the appearance of the territory and water area. As a rule, it is of a medium or small scale and is of an overview nature. The physical map shows in detail the relief and hydrography, as well as sands, glaciers, floating ice, nature reserves, and mineral deposits; in less detail - socio-economic elements (settlements, communication routes, borders, etc.).
Often physical maps are created as educational ones. They are widely used in primary, secondary and higher schools when studying geography (usually included in school atlases or created in a wall version). Wall physical maps have a large format, large signs and inscriptions are used on them, river lines and boundaries are thickened, and minerals are designated in large numbers. Often such cards have two plans: an image of the main. objects are designed to be viewed in a classroom (auditorium) from a great distance, and less significant details are clearly readable only when viewed closely. Wall maps, as a rule, consist of several sheets; they are glued to fabric for greater safety and equipped with devices for hanging on the wall. Wall-mounted educational maps of the world are most often created on a scale of 1:15,000,000 - 1:20,000,000, maps of Russia - on a scale of 1: 4,000,000 or 1:5,000,000, which allows them to be placed on the classroom wall or on a chalkboard. The scale of maps of individual continents and natural regions depends on their size.

The physical map of Russia gives a visual representation of the complex relief, different in origin, history of formation and external morphological characteristics. It is distinguished by great contrasts: on the Russian and West Siberian plains, elevation differences amount to tens of meters, and in the mountains in the south and east of the country they reach hundreds of meters. In the north of the Russian Plain rise the low mountain ranges of Khibiny, Timan, Pai-Khoi, and in the south the plain passes into the Caspian and Azov lowlands, between which stretch the foothills, and then the mountain structures of the Caucasus.
The relatively low and flattened Ural Range. separates European Russia from the vast plains of the West. Siberia, which further to the east are replaced by the vast Central Siberian Plateau, and then by the Far Eastern and Pacific mountain belts. In the south of Russia there are systems of ridges and highlands, reaching heights of 3000–5000 m.
Thanks to the coloring used on the physical map, the general slope of the territory in the north is clearly visible, emphasized by the flow of large rivers flowing into the north. Arctic Ocean. A physical map is basic when studying the geography of the country; it provides the basis for understanding the main natural features of Russia, its climatic zonation, latitudinal distribution of permafrost, soil, plant, landscape zones, manifestations of altitudinal zonation in the mountains. Moreover, analysis of the physical map makes it possible to clearly present Ch. factors that determined the distribution of the population, the length of the railway. highways, understand the general patterns of households. development of vast spaces of Russia. Continents and continents: Eurasia, Africa, North America, South America, Australia, Antarctica. The largest continent is Eurasia.

Oceans of the world: There are four oceans in the world - Pacific, Atlantic, Arctic and Indian. The largest ocean in the world - Pacific Ocean.

Largest seas in the world in descending order of area: the largest sea in the world - Sargasso Sea, followed by the Philippine Sea, Coral Sea, Arabian Sea, South China Sea, Tasman Sea, Fiji Sea, Weddell Sea, Caribbean Sea, Mediterranean Sea, Bering Sea, Bay of Bengal, Sea of ​​Okhotsk, Gulf of Mexico, Barents Sea, Norwegian Sea, Scotia Sea, Hudson Bay, Greenland Sea, Somov Sea, Riiser-Larsen Sea, Japan Sea, Arafura Sea, East Siberian Sea.

The largest islands in the world in descending order of area: the largest island in the world - Greenland, followed by the islands: New Guinea, Kalimantan, Madagascar, Baffin Island, Sumatra, Great Britain, Honshu, Victoria, Ellesmere, Sulawesi, South Island (New Zealand), Java, North Island (New Zealand), Luzon, Newfoundland, Cuba, Iceland, Mindanao, Ireland, Hokkaido, Haiti, Sakhalin, Banks, Sri Lanka.

The longest rivers in the world: the largest river in the world - Amazon, after it there are rivers: Nile, Mississippi - Missouri - Jefferson, Yangtze, Yellow River, Ob - Irtysh, Yenisei - Angara - Selenga - Ider, Lena - Vitim, Amur - Argun - Muddy Channel - Kerulen, Congo - Lualaba - Luvoa - Luapula - Chambeshi, Mekong, Mackenzie - Slave - Peace - Finlay, Niger, La Plata - Parana - Rio Grande, Volga - Kama.

The highest mountains with a height of more than 8 km: the largest mountain in the world - Chomolungma, a little lower are the mountains: Chogori, Kanchenjunga, Lhotse, Makalu, Cho Oyu, Dhaulagiri, Manaslu, Nangaparbat, Annapurna I, Gasherbrum I, Broad Peak, Gasherbrum II and Shishabangma.

The largest lakes by continent: in Africa Lake Victoria, in Antarctica the subglacial Lake Vostok, in Asia - the salty Caspian Sea and fresh Lake Baikal, in Australia Lake Eyre, in Europe - the salty Caspian Sea and fresh Lake Ladoga, in North America - Lake Michigan-Huron, in South America America - salt lake Maracaibo and fresh lake Titicaca. The largest lake in the world is the Caspian Sea.
